Figure 5: when expressed from plasmids, dkgA was found to decrease furfural tolerance. Figure 6: Deletions of dkgA caused an increase in furfural tolerance and a decrease in furfural reductase activity in vivo similar to the results shown in the EMFR9 strain of E. coli. Since deletion of dkgA alone did not lower the in vivo reductase activity or increase furfural tolerance, another gene, yqhD, is presumed to be the more important activity for growth inhibition by low concentrations of furfural. The lowest furfural reductase activity, however, was found after deletion of both genes as seen in Figure 3. |
